| 1a - 2d | 3a 3b 3c | 4a 4b | 5 | 6a 6b | 7a 7b 7c | 8a 8b | 9a 9b | 10a 10b | 11a 11b 11c 11d | Mk 11:10b ... "Hosanna in the highest!"
The 4th phrase has these 4 dialog words, ... Hōsanna en tois hupsistois ("Hosanna in the highest")! The 4 dialog words are bottom up. The word "Hōsanna" is derived from the Hebrew "yasha na" meaning "please save (us)." The word "hupsistois" (highest) is the Jewish crowd calling on the name of their highest savior King, David who killed Goliath.
